Tiger Face Emoji Meaning

The ðŸŊ emoji is often referred to as the "Tiger Face" due to its depiction of a stylized tiger's head. The emoji features a bold and vibrant orange color, with a distinctive black stripe running down the face, giving it a menacing yet charismatic appearance. When used in digital communication, this emoji is typically meant to convey strength, courage, and confidence.

In everyday conversations, the Tiger Face emoji is commonly employed to express enthusiasm or excitement about something. For instance, if someone shares news of a new video game release, they might send a Tiger Face emoji to show their eagerness to play it. This emoji has also been used in social media posts and Instagram captions to add a touch of drama or playfulness. It's not uncommon to see the Tiger Face emoji copied and pasted into texts from friends or acquaintances who want to inject some personality into their messages.

Interestingly, the use of the Tiger Face emoji is deeply rooted in cultural traditions associated with animals and nature. In many Asian cultures, tigers are revered as powerful symbols of strength and resilience. When used in digital communication, the ðŸŊ emoji can be seen as a nod to these cultural associations. Technical Information

  • Emoji: ðŸŊ
  • Emoji Name: Tiger Face
  • Codepoints: U+1F42F
  • HTML Entity: 🐯
  • Shortcodes: :tiger_face:
  • Keywords: tiger, face, animals, nature, emoji
  • Category: Animals & Nature
  • Unicode Version: 0.6
